#725119 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#725119 is composed of 44.7% red, 31.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.9%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 37.8 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 27.3%. #725119 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4a232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#725119 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

#725119 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#725119 has RGB values of R:114, G:81,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.78,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7491865.

Shades and Tints of #725119

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#725119

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474644 is the less saturated color, while #875704 is the most saturated one.
